Would you consider SBRT to a perirectal node after previous external beam and prostate brachytherapy?

1 Answers
Mednet Member
Mednet Member
Radiation Oncology · Beth Israel Deaconess Medical Center/Harvard Medical School

It is dependent on many variables. If the perirectal lymph nodes are the only site of metastatic disease, then radiation should be considered.
